Warning Signs You Need Flooring Replacement After Water Damage
Don’t ignore these warning signs, they can lead to bigger problems down the line. Catching them early can save you money and prevent further damage.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, persistent musty odors can show the presence of mold or mildew. If you notice these odors, it’s essential to take action quickly to prevent further damage.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of underlying damage. If you notice this, it’s essential to investigate further to find out the extent of the damage.
Discoloration or Staining
Discoloration or staining on your flooring can be a sign of water damage. If you notice this, it’s essential to take action quickly to prevent further damage.
Soft or Spongy Flooring
Soft or spongy flooring can be a sign of water damage. If you notice this, it’s essential to investigate further to find out the extent of the damage.
Water Stains or Rings
Water stains or rings on your flooring can be a sign of water damage. If you notice this, it’s essential to take action quickly to prevent further damage.
Peeling or Cracking Paint
Peeling or cracking paint can be a sign of water damage. If you notice this, it’s essential to investigate further to find out the extent of the damage.

Flooring Replacement After Water Damage Cost in Wilkeson, WA
The cost of Flooring Replacement After Water Damage can vary widely dep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Wilkeson, WA. These estimates are based on industry standards and may vary depending on your specific situation.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Emergency Response and Assessment | $500 – $2,500 | Severity and size of damage, location, and local conditions |
| Water Extraction and Drying |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of flooring, and equipment required |
| Flooring Removal and Replacement | $2,000 – $10,000 | Type of flooring, size of affected area, and local labor costs |
| Final Inspection and Cleaning |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area and type of flooring |
| More Services (mold remediation, etc.) | $1,000 – $5,000 | Severity and size of damage, type of service required |
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ment and may vary depending on your specific situation. We offer free estimates to help you understand the costs involved.

Q: How long will the restoration process take?
A: The restoration process can take anywhere from a few days to several weeks, depending on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. We’ll provide a customized timeline based on your specific situation.
Q: Is Flooring Replacement After Water Damage a health risk?
A: Yes, water damage can create an environment conducive to mold and mildew growth, which can pose health risks. But, with prompt attention and proper restoration, you can reduce the risks.
Q: Can I replace the flooring myself?
A: While it’s possible to replace flooring yourself, it’s often not the best option. Water damage can create underlying issues that need specialized expertise to address. We recommend hiring a professional to ensure a safe and durable finish.
